India, March 16 -- A special court in Veraval in Gir Somnath district on Monday convicted five men in the 2016 flogging of Dalit men in Una, the incident which triggered protests across Gujarat after a video of the assault circulated widely on social media. The court has reserved the quantum of punishment.
District government pleader Ketansinh D Vala said the Special Atrocity Court found the accused guilty under provisions of the Indian Penal Code (IPC) and the Scheduled Castes and Scheduled Tribes (Prevention of Atrocities) Act after examining oral and documentary evidence during the trial.
